Designed by Note (design studio), the Cita (Spanish word for date) bench is part of a collection made to create shared spaces. With its friendly lines and a slightly retro style, its modular structure and subtle aesthetic allow for the creation of versatile and welcoming environments. It also encourages interaction and closeness, whether in a workplace, a restaurant, or the kitchen at home.
